The differences between auto repair shop managers and body shop managers can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a body shop manager has an average salary of $76,262, which is higher than the $68,078 average annual salary of an auto repair shop manager.
The top three skills for an auto repair shop manager include customer service, repair process and body shop. The most important skills for a body shop manager are dealership, customer service, and customer satisfaction.
